Which One Of These Hip-Hop Groups Deserves A Spot To Compete For Greatest Of All-Time?

“Finding the GOAT Group,” the fourth installment of Ambrosia For Heads’s annual competition series features Hip-Hop’s greatest groups vying for the #1 spot. Sixty-two groups have been pre-selected by a panel of experts, competing to advance to the Top 32, and one slot will be reserved for a wild-card entry, including the possibility for write-in candidates, to ensure no deserving band of MCs and DJs is neglected. The 2018 contest consists of seven rounds, NCAA basketball-tournament style, leading to a Top 32, then the Sweet 16 and so on, until one winner is determined. For each match-up, two groups are pitted against one another with a ballot to decide which one advances to the next round.
